  • The overall objective of the Micro-Enterprises Support Programme Trust (MESPT) is to promote economic growth, employment creation and poverty alleviation through support to enterprises. MESPT works with intermediaries that provide financial or business development services to improve the performance of enterprises. The aim is to strengthen financial intermed...

    Communication and PR Manager

    Key Responsibilities

    • Strategic Corporate Communications, Public Affairs & Reputation Management
    • Develop and lead an integrated Corporate Communications & PR Strategy that strengthens MESPT’s institutional brand across both the financial services arm and donor-funded programmes.
    • Work closely with the Head of Fundraising and Partnerships to support donor positioning, partnership cultivation, institutional profiling, and resource mobilization.
    • Protect and strengthen brand integrity by enforcing consistent messaging, tone, and visual identity across all communication platforms and materials.
    • Ensure compliance with donor visibility guidelines, internal governance policies, and programme communication standards through collaboration with internal teams and external service providers.
    • Drive public affairs and policy communications including issue framing, stakeholder engagement, and proactive positioning on sector and regulatory matters relevant to MESPT’s mandate.
    • Lead issues management, crisis communication, and reputational risk strategy, including monitoring public sentiment and coordinating response actions.
    • Serve as a strategic advisor to senior leadership on internal and external messaging, ensuring responses are timely, accurate, coordinated, and consistent.
    • Prepare and manage the annual communications workplan, content calendar, campaigns, and publication timelines.
    • Translate programme results into high-impact communication products tailored to youth, communities, donors, government, private sector, and partners.
    • Digital Communications, Internal Engagement & Brand Visibility
    • Lead MESPT’s digital communications strategy to strengthen visibility, engagement, and brand presence across platforms.
    • Oversee website content updates, social media publishing, digital campaigns and paid promotions (where applicable).
    • Ensure consistent branding, institutional and programs identity across all digital channels and communication products.
    • Drive youth-focused engagement through modern formats such as reels, short videos, infographics and podcast clips.
    • Track and analyze digital performance metrics and optimize campaigns using data insights.
    • Establish and support an internal communications champions’ network to amplify approved messaging while ensuring compliance with brand and digital conduct standards.
    • Build staff capacity through coaching on responsible digital engagement, storytelling, and social media advocacy.
    • Lead change communication initiatives supporting organizational transformation and culture strengthening.
    • Stakeholder Communications, Partner Visibility & Donor Engagement
    • Work closely with the Head of Fundraising and Partnerships to coordinate stakeholder and partner communications to ensure consistent messaging across programme partners and platforms.
    • Support partner visibility, co-branding, and donor acknowledgement in line with donor visibility requirements.
    • Develop and maintain standardized key messaging packs for strategic engagements with government, donors, private sector, and learning platforms.
    • Provide communications support for high-profile events including programme launches, policy dialogues, exhibitions and summits.
    • Support packaging of donor- and investor-facing materials including partnership briefs, concept notes, pitch materials and impact narratives.
    • Manage strategic communications engagement with donors and development partners to strengthen confidence in MESPT’s work and results.
    • Media Relations & Public Relations
    • Manage external visibility through proactive media engagement including press releases, advisories, conferences, interviews, and spokesperson support.
    • Build and maintain relationships with journalists, editors, producers and media houses.
    • Identify and manage PR opportunities including awards, publications, thought leadership placements and speaking engagements.
    • Monitor media coverage and develop regular media intelligence reports including sentiment analysis.
    • Impact Storytelling & Content Development
    • Lead production of compelling impact stories including beneficiary/youth spotlights, human-interest stories, success narratives and finance access stories.
    • Produce and quality-assure communications products including brochures, factsheets, newsletters, annual reports, case studies, donor briefs and pitch decks.
    • Ensuring content consistently demonstrates results, learning, innovation and systems change.
    • Coordinate ethical photo/video documentation during field missions and stakeholder engagements.
    • Safeguarding, Ethics & Consent Compliance (Critical)
    • Ensure safeguarding compliance in all communications, including informed consent, safe photography, confidentiality, and dignity-first portrayal.
    • Prevent harmful storytelling practices including stereotyping, exploitation or inappropriate disclosure.
    • Implement safeguarding review systems for sensitive content and ensure incident-free communications practices.
    • Train staff and partners on ethical storytelling and consent standards.
    • Knowledge Management, Learning & Influence
    • Package programme evidence, learning and insights into knowledge products such as learning briefs, toolkits, policy briefs and case studies.
    • Support documentation of models and approaches that demonstrate innovation and scalability.
    • Support policy influence and advocacy through targeted messaging and content development.
    • Events, Engagements, Visibility & Protocol
    • Lead visibility planning and communications for institutional and programme events.
    • Develop speeches, scripts, talking points, stakeholder invitations, event branding materials, protocol arrangements and media coordination plans.
    • Provide communications and protocol support for VIP visits, donor missions, investor engagements and government delegations.
    • Lead planning and delivery of MESPT’s flagship BDCG Annual Conference, including messaging, branding, speaker positioning, media engagement, content development and post-event visibility.
    • Ensure all events achieve strong documentation, media coverage and post-event reporting aligned to donor and institutional standards.
    • Perform any other duties assigned by the Supervisor from time to time.

    Key Deliverables

    • Improved institutional visibility and brand perception among donors, government, partners, communities and media.
    • Communications Strategy implemented with ≥90% annual deliverables achieved.
    • Fundraising and partnership support strengthened through high-quality communication products and stakeholder materials.
    • Increased positive media performance (volume, reach and sentiment).
    • Digital growth achieved including improved reach, engagement and audience growth.
    • Quarterly impact stories and knowledge products delivered on time.
    • BDCG Annual Conference delivered successfully with strong visibility outputs and stakeholder feedback.
    • Timely donor and investor communications delivered to standard.
    • Zero safeguarding breaches in all communications content and media documentation.
    • Effective management of reputational risks and crisis communications.
    • Strengthened internal communications and staff alignment.
    • Full budget and governance compliance maintained.

    Knowledge, Experience & Skills

    • Minimum 7 years progressive experience in communications/PR, preferably in donor-funded programmes, youth development, livelihoods, finance, agriculture, inclusion, or climate-related programmes.
    • Proven experience developing and implementing communication strategies.
    • Strong media relations and public engagement experience.
    • Proven ability to produce donor-quality communication products and reports.
    • Excellent writing and editing skills (development communications and news writing).
    • Strong digital communications skills (content strategy, publishing calendars, analytics).
    • Strong branding, messaging and stakeholder engagement competence.
